    So oddly, I went NuPrime ST-10 (unmodified) --> Odyssey Stratos+ in Khartago case --> NuPrime ST-10 (upgraded by TDSS) --> Odyssey Stratos Extreme in proper case.

    So, I've basically gone back and forth from two very different iterations of two very different amplifiers. Stunning differences and you could almost make a case that both are welcome (upgraded ST-10 and Stratos Extreme) but since I only keep one at a time, the Extreme is a clear winner. It has all the nuance and subtlety of the upgraded ST-10, and then some, but the dynamic swings just get into your soul with this amp. The ST-10 can do that reasonably well but this Extreme monster just takes it to a whole nother level. I was hearing into music that I had heard further into with the upgraded ST-10. And then there's the "drive" of the music. I always felt like the ST-10 was excellent at moderate volume but keep going up and it collapsed in on itself. The upgraded version less-so than the unmodified one, but at least on these speakers, it just couldn't keep up. The Extreme has no such issue.
